Can a tenant deny entry to your landlord? Usually, a tenant can deny entry to your landlord centered on their own suitable to privacy, Despite the fact that you will discover exceptions. A tenant are not able to deny entry if there is an unexpected emergency the landlord desires to deal with, Should the tenant has deserted the assets, or, in some cases, In case the police are responding to a crime.

The Honest Housing Act was place set up to stop housing discrimination depending on quite a few factors, such as race, religion, nationwide origin, sexual intercourse, handicap, and familial standing. Many states and towns even have their own reasonable housing laws which offer supplemental protections to specified classes that aren't included by the federal Honest Housing Act.

If your landlord would like to evict you within a lawful way, all relevant eviction methods, which include sufficient recognize And perhaps a court judgment, should be followed.
In many states, they can withhold rent until eventually the repairs are accomplished. Tenants also can make the repairs on their own and afterwards deduct their Price tag in the rent, Despite the fact that this is not an option in every state. Other available choices include building the repairs and suing the landlord for the price of the repairs in compact claims court docket, as well as payment for similar accidents or assets hurt. Or you are able to inform a housing inspector to the challenge if it violates a developing code.
